Industrial Manufacturing Standards: The Anatomy of CE Certified Freight Vessels

As modern international supply chains demand higher speed, environmental compliance, and structural longevity, selecting a certified CE Certified Express Freight Manufacturer & Factory has become a vital operational imperative for commercial fleet managers, logistics operators, and marine charter enterprises. Commercial marine express freight vessels operate under severe dynamic loads, saltwater corrosion, and rigorous operational cycles. Achieving genuine CE certification (Directive 2013/53/EU) demands uncompromising metallurgical engineering, advanced hydrodynamics, and verified structural integrity.

Our manufacturing facility leverages marine-grade 5083-H116 and 5086-H116 aluminum alloys, renowned for superior tensile strength, exceptional fatigue resistance, and absolute resistance to intergranular corrosion in harsh ocean environments. Unlike conventional fiberglass (FRP) structures that suffer from osmosis and UV degradation over long operating windows, robotic pulse-MIG welded aluminum hull structures deliver a high strength-to-weight ratio that yields substantial fuel efficiency gains and higher payload capacity during high-speed freight transits.

Technical Insight: Aluminum 5083-H116 features a yield strength of 215 MPa and ultimate tensile strength of 305 MPa. By integrating longitudinal framing systems with automated double-continuous seam welding, our hulls maintain structural rigidity under wave impacts exceeding 4.5 meters in offshore Category B commercial operations.

Market Intelligence: Future Procurement Trends for Express Freight & Charter Vessels

The global marine express transportation and commercial charter market is undergoing a structural transition driven by decarbonization mandates, digital telemetry integration, and demand for rapid coastal cargo distribution. Forward-thinking buyers and enterprise fleets are evaluating four core technological vectors for 2026-2035 fleet acquisitions:

1. Hybrid & Multi-Engine Outboard Propulsion

Modern fast freight catamarans are adopting twin or quad high-output outboard engines paired with lithium-iron-phosphate (LFP) auxiliary power banks. This reduces dockside idle emissions and cuts fuel consumption by 18-22% during low-speed harbor maneuvers.

2. Hydrofoil-Assisted Catamaran Hulls

By incorporating foil-assisted hull geometry between asymmetric twin hulls, dynamic lift reduces hydrodynamic wetted surface area at speeds above 25 knots. This yields higher cruising velocity for express freight without escalating horsepower requirements.

3. Autonomous Telemetry & Remote Monitoring

Fleet managers now demand real-time NMEA 2000 data integration via satellite uplinks, monitoring hull stress sensors, engine fuel burn rates, GPS location, and preventive maintenance alerts across Transpacific and European charter routes.

Frequently Asked Questions (FAQ)

Comprehensive technical and procurement answers for commercial buyers, charter companies, and freight managers.

Q1: What does "CE Certified" signify for commercial express freight and charter vessels?

CE Certification indicates that the vessel complies with strict safety, health, and environmental protection standards mandated by European Union Directive 2013/53/EU. Vessels certified under Category B (Offshore) are engineered to withstand wind forces up to Beaufort Force 8 and wave heights up to 4 meters, ensuring total seaworthiness for commercial express cargo and charter passengers.

Q2: Why is marine-grade 5083-H116 aluminum preferred over fiberglass for express freight boats?

Marine-grade 5083-H116 aluminum offers superior strength-to-weight performance, enabling higher speed and fuel economy. Additionally, aluminum is completely impervious to osmotic water absorption, will not crack under structural impact, and is 100% recyclable, offering long-term structural integrity and significantly higher residual value.

Q3: How are large aluminum vessels (e.g., 11.6m catamarans or 18m workboats) shipped internationally?

Through our integrated FMC-licensed NVOCC freight platform (Intertrans Express Inc.), we engineer custom steel shipping cradles for your vessel. Depending on overall dimensions, boats are shipped via 40ft Flat Rack containers, Breakbulk ocean service, or Roll-on/Roll-off (Ro-Ro) vessels with full marine insurance coverage and CTPAT customs clearance.
